文章 2022-05-27 来自:开发者社区

python3入门笔记四之函数式编程---高阶函数,返回函数,匿名函数,装饰器,偏函数

函数式编程函数式编程的一个特点就是,允许把函数本身作为参数传入另一个函数,还允许返回一个函数! Python对函数式编程提供部分支持。由于Python允许使用变量,因此,Python不是纯函数式编程语言高阶函数(Higher-order function)特点:变量可以指向函数 即 函数本身也可以赋值给变量 x=abs x(-10) #10函数名也是变量 abs = 10  abs(-....

文章 2022-01-05 来自:开发者社区

《Python入门到精通》函数

函数1. 调用函数2. 参数3. 返回值4. 递归函数就是把具有 「独立功能」的代码块封装成一个小模块,可以直接调用,从而提高代码的编写 「效率」以及重用性语法def 函数名( 参数1, 参数2, ……): 代码块(函数调用时执行)1. 调用函数使用 def 关键字创建函数,根据「函数名」调用函数注意:Python中的函数调用必须在函数定义之后def fun(): print('函数...

文章 2021-12-21 来自:开发者社区

【python入门到精通】一文让你彻底搞懂python的函数

作者 :“大数据小禅” 粉丝福利 :加入小禅的大数据社群 欢迎小伙伴们 点赞、收藏⭐、留言目录Python中的函数及其调用对于函数的理解:python中的自定义函数自定义空函数Python特性之让函数返回多个值核心注意点:实战部分: 函数核心知识之函数的递归算法最终结束条件,比如下面的if n==1。实例部分,使用递归,做阶乘运算 4! 4*3 *2 *1=24Python中的函数及其调用对于.....

【python入门到精通】一文让你彻底搞懂python的函数
文章 2019-07-07 来自:开发者社区

Python3入门(七)函数

函数是组织好的,可重复使用的,用来实现单一,或相关联功能的代码段。函数能提高应用的模块性,和代码的重复利用率。你已经知道Python提供了许多内建函数,比如print()。但你也可以自己创建函数,这被叫做用户自定义函数 一、定义一个函数 定义一个由自己想要功能的函数,以下是简单的规则 函数代码块以 def 关键词开头,后接函数标识符名称和圆括号 () 任何传入参数和自变量必须放在圆括号中间,圆.....

文章 2018-02-23 来自:开发者社区

Python入门(四)数学类函数总结

数学常量 圆周率:pi; 自然常数:e。 数学函数 返回数字的绝对值,且值的类型取决于原参数的类型(复数返回浮点型):abs( x )x---数值 >>> abs(-1.23) 1.23 >>> abs(3+4j) 5.0 返回浮点数或整数的绝对值,且值的类型只能是浮点型:fabs( x )x---数值 >>> import math ...

文章 2018-01-21 来自:开发者社区

Python入门:内置函数

  可创建一个整数列表,一般用在 for 循环中。 函数语法 range(start, stop[, step]) 参数说明: start: 计数从 start 开始。默认是从 0 开始。例如range(5)等价于range(0, 5); end: 计数到 end 结束,但不包括 end。例如:range(0, 5) 是[0, 1, 2, 3, 4]没有5 step:步长,默认为1。例如...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Python学习站

Python学习资料大全,包含Python编程学习、实战案例分享、开发者必知词条等内容。

+关注
相关镜像